‘The Sopranos’ Star Drea de Matteo Says Onlyfans ‘Saved’ Her After Vaccine Stance Lost Her Roles

[ad_1]

Drea de Matteo opens up about how joining Onlyfans “saved” her amid financial struggles.

The “Sopranos” star, 52, who joined the adult subscription website in August, said in a interview with DailyMail He posted Tuesday that he nearly lost his house and only had $10 in his bank account before posting content on the platform.

“OnlyFans 100 percent saved my life,” he said. “I can’t believe I’m saying that, but he really saved us.”

Matteo previously revealed that he was unable to get work in Hollywood due to his refusal to get the Vaccine for COVID-19.

“I was put into foreclosure and my house had flooded, so I was trying to sell the house quickly. I wanted to try to sell it before they took it away,” she told DailyMail. “At the same time, I lost my mother, and my other mother, who has dementia, had run out of money for her caregiver. I didn’t know what path I would take.”

The actress said that within five minutes of posting on Onlyfans she made enough money to pay for her house and launch an urban clothing brand as a secondary source of income.

“Anyone who wants to condemn me and belittle me, let them do it. I just hope they never find themselves in the position I was in taking care of two young children,” she said.

Matteo shares daughter Alabama Gypsyrose, 16, and son Waylon Albert “Blackjack,” 12, with ex Shooter Jennings.

In an interview with Fox News In September, the actress said she was forced to “change careers and discover new things because my own industry thinks I’m a savage,” referring to her stance against COVID-19 vaccine mandates. “I guess you could say she was a bad girl because I didn’t follow the rules a couple of years ago.”

“I used to have a lot of money. And then all of a sudden I went from being allowed to work to never being allowed to work again,” Matteo said. “I was never the type of actor to take jobs just to stay in the business. I literally took jobs to feed my family.”

Matteo appeared on “The Sopranos” as a series regular for the first five seasons. In 2004, she won an Emmy for Supporting Actress in a Drama Series for her portrayal of La Cerva.

He also appeared regularly on “Sons of Anarchy” and “Shades of Blue.”

Matteo is the latest in a series of celebrities to embrace the subscription platform, including Cardi B, Carmen Electra, Bella Thorne, Denise Richards, Amber Rose, Tyga and Chris Brown.
